121. How much water is in your beef burger, the chicken burger and the Nuggetts
The beef that McDonald’s uses is 100 percent beef, from cuts of forequarter and flank and therefore, does not contain any water. However, if you are talking about the whole burger, with bun, sauces and cheese, then some of these will contain water as one of the ingredients. For example, the burger bun consists of 30 percent water, the Big Mac sauce consists of 29 percent water, and Chicken McNuggets contain 15 percent water. 124. I heard that your burge meat is taken from from the vagina of cows. Can you confirm 100% that this is not true?
McDonald's only uses whole cuts of forequarter and flank of 100 percent beef. McDonald's UK source nearly all the meat from farmers in the UK and Ireland. McDonald's has a policy to source the beef locally wherever possible and last year over 16,000 British and Irish farmers supplied us with beef. In times of particularly high demand the company also source from farms in the European Union. All these farms produce to the same industry leading standards, and McDonald's is able to trace exactly which farms our beef comes from, the farmers' names and how the animals were reared.

126. is the meat the burgers are made from just left over scrap?
No. McDonald's only uses whole cuts of 100 percent beef forequarter and flank, nothing else. Skilled butchers prepare the beef just as they would in a butcher's shop, taking care to trim the meat to our standards prior to delivery to the company that makes the hamburger patties.
